Title :
Implementation of Fuzzy Logic Controller with Bifurcation Control of a Current-mode Boost Converter

Abstract :
This paper presents the design of a basic fuzzy logic controller for switching current-mode DC/DC boost converters. The proposed simple fuzzy logic controllers used only nine rules to regulate output voltage. Moreover, they provide an optimal slope compensation to keep the system adequately remote from the first bifurcation point by means of stabilizing around the reference signal. In spite of nonlinear characteristics and instabilities of the converter, the performance of the closed-loop control system can be considerably improved to avoid bifurcation phenomena. The experimental results found that these techniques introduced in this paper give satisfactory results with the regulating and tracking modes under changes in operating conditions.
